The Chungsong Bridge is a road bridge in the North Korean capital Pyongyang . It connects the district of P'yŏngch'ŏn-guyŏk with the districts of Nakrang-dong and Chungsong-dong via Chollima Street with the district of Rakrang-guyŏk and the Pyongyang-Kaesŏng expressway . It is the most westerly of the six bridges that lead over the Taedong Gang in Pyongyang . The bridge was completed in 1983.

The bridge has two tracks in each direction of travel and one track for the tram. There is a pedestrian walkway on both sides. It has an entrance to Ssuk-sŏm Island , where the Ssuk-sŏm Historical Revolutionary Memorial and the Palace of Science and Technology , opened in 2016, are located. A line of the trolleybus Pyongyang also goes there . Following its course to the south, the road leads directly to the memorial for the reunification and provides a connection to Tongil Road .
